Can RA cause LUPUS?

RA is rheumatoid arthritis. Rheumatoid arthritis is an autoimmune disease in which the immune system attacks and destroys the joints. Lupus is an autoimmune disease that can affect virtually any part of the body. Lupus does not destroy joints, but it does cause pain and inflammation.Rheumatoid arthritis does not cause lupus, but it is common to have more than one autoimmune disease in overlap.

What is rheumatism?

AnswerRheumatoid Arthritis is an auto-immune form of arthritis in which your body attacks your joints. It's very painful and destructive. Medication is available to stop or significantly slow the progression of the disease.
